    PATCH 1.0.1.28

    A new spell evolution system has arrived!

    Tablets of Ascension allow you to upgrade your Gilded and Exalted spells into even more powerful, altered versions. Each tablet unlocks new mechanics, synergies, and strategic advantages that reshape how you use your spells in combat.

    How It Works: Find Tablets of Ascension scattered across the game world guarded by powerful enemies, or rewarded from puzzles. Consume the Tablet to upgrade a specific Gilded or Exalted spell into a new version with additional effects. The spells upgrade from Gilded -> Exalted -> Ascendant. Some upgrades add new mechanics, some increase power, and some introduce risk-reward elements to combat. Below is a list of the tablets available in this patch, where to find them, and how they modify your spells. I'll introduce more on patches.

    Eldritch Tablet I
    Effect: Upgrades Gilded Eldritch Blast → Exalted Eldritch Blast
    New Effect: Beams bounce to one additional enemy.Location: Dropped by boss Selorm (Act 1)
    Eldritch Tablet II
    Effect: Upgrades Exalted Eldritch Blast → Ascendant Eldritch Blast
    New Effect: Beams now bounce to two additional enemies.Location: Dropped by boss Spirit of Talos (Act 3)
    Fireball Tablet II
    Effect: Upgrades Exalted Fireball → Ascendant Fireball
    New Effect: Releases multiple fireballs around you at random locations upon casting. Location: Dropped by Tormentor Null (Act 2, Gauntlet of Shar)
    Scorching Ray Tablet I
    Effect: Upgrades Gilded Scorching Ray → Exalted Scorching Ray
    New Effect: All party members who have learned Gilded Scorching Ray will automatically fire it at the same target when you cast Exalted Scorching Ray.Location: Dropped by Mummy Agatha (Nautilus)
    Crippling Pinch Tablet I
    Effect: Upgrades Gilded Crippling Pinch → Exalted Crippling Pinch
    New Effect: Applies Hold Monster on the target for 1 turn. (Target must be prone before use).Location: Dropped by Tormentor Null (Act 2)
    Diving Strike Tablet I
    Effect: Upgrades Gilded Diving Strike → Exalted Diving StrikeNew Effect: After landing a successful Diving Strike, you can cast it again as a bonus action.Location: Bought from Act 1 Goldmember Vendor
    Moonbeam Tablet I
    Effect: Upgrades Gilded Moonbeam → Exalted Moonbeam
    New Effect: You can cast Moonbeam on three different targets, and also move all three beams again to new targets. Location: Dropped by Boss Selorm (Act 1)
    Smite Tablet I
    Effect: Upgrades Gilded Divine Smite → Exalted Divine Smite
    New Effect: You gain advantage on concentration saving throws and become immune to prone for 2 turns after landing a smite.Location: Solve Egor’s Riddle (Act 1)







    Patch 1.0.1.26: The Gilded Compendium Arrives!

    A major overhaul to spell progression. The new Gilded Compendium lets you choose your spells instead of relying on random chance.Now that I have changed the system I can add more spells and do more cool stuff that you guys have suggested. Test and give me your feedback of the new system.

     Gilded Compendium Learn Gilded and Exalted spells by consuming Codexes and spending Goldbars.Gilded Spells: Gain Gilded Knowledge by using Shimmering Codexes. Spend 5 Goldbars to unlock a spell of your choice. Exalted Spells: Gain Exalted Knowledge by using Master’s Tomes. Spend 15 Goldbars to unlock a powerful Exalted spell.

    Gilded Gateway ChangesT2 & T3 spells removed and moved into the Gilded Compendium for direct selection.T1 spells remain unchanged – still available randomly by consuming 4 Goldbars.Arcane Repository stays the same – consume 30 Goldbars + 1 Eternal Manuscript for a powerful effect.T4 spells remain in Gilded Gateway for those seeking the ultimate magical gamble.This update gives you more control over your spell choices, making progression smoother and more rewarding. Time to forge your legend with the Gilded Compendium!
